The National Library of Australia(NLA), while formally established by the
passage of the National Library Act, 1960, it is the country's largest
reference library.
The role is to ensure that documentary
resources of national significance
relating to Australia and the Australian
people, as well as significant non-
Australian library materials, are
collected, preserved and made
accessible either through the Library
itself or through collaborative
arrangements with other libraries and
information providers.

The Library has Australia's largest and most diverse collection
of information resources and services - over 9 million items
including books, maps, pictures, manuscripts and oral histories.
Through the internet library provide a range of information
including our catalogue, journal indexes, databases and guides,
exhibitions, What‘s on and access to our publications through
the online shop.

Reading Rooms
The Library’s reading rooms provide access to:
• the collections
• expert staff to provide assistance
• electronic resources such as journals, indexes and databases
• computers with Internet and Microsoft Office suite
• the Library’s online catalogue and website
• reference collections
• photocopiers, printers
• free Wi-Fi network

ASK NOW—Chat with a librarian
Ask Now:information professionals are waiting online to help with your query.
Ask Now is a virtual reference service staffed by librarians in Australia
and New Zealand. It aims to provide high quality information to users,
with the convenience of immediate, online communication. Using
purpose-built software [question point], it allows librarians and users to
interact in real time.

14. National Library of Australia:Objective
NLA’s objective is to ensure Australians have access to a national
collection of library material to enhance learning, knowledge creation,
enjoyment and understanding of Australian life and society.
